起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1659|回复: 3

[处理中3] 如何拦截http请求?

[复制链接]

11

主题

26

帖子

62

积分

初级会员

Rank: 2

积分
62
QQ
发表于 2017-12-15 08:49:44 | 显示全部楼层 |阅读模式
我以前的做法是在WebViewClient中拦截处理,如果本地有数据,就是用本地数据,如果没有,再请求网络数据。

Wex5有类似的吗
发表于 2017-12-15 14:36:02 | 显示全部楼层
本地有数据??是指什么数据??如果是数据库中的数据,那肯定就是请求服务器获取的!
如果是缓存资源!就是优先访问本地缓存,本地没有就去请求服务器!
浏览器默认机制就是这样的!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

11

主题

26

帖子

62

积分

初级会员

Rank: 2

积分
62
QQ
 楼主| 发表于 2017-12-21 08:25:51 | 显示全部楼层
liangyongfei 发表于 2017-12-15 14:36
本地有数据??是指什么数据??如果是数据库中的数据,那肯定就是请求服务器获取的!
如果是缓存资源!就 ...

在http请求之前对http进行处理,比如地址、内容,如果有本地有的话,就返回,如果没有,再进行http网络请求。
浏览器那个是自动的,不能自己处理。
回复 支持 反对

使用道具 举报

发表于 2017-12-21 09:59:14 | 显示全部楼层
rendtime 发表于 2017-12-21 08:25
在http请求之前对http进行处理,比如地址、内容,如果有本地有的话,就返回,如果没有,再进行http网络请 ...

这个你上网查下吧!就是浏览器自动处理的机制! 无法 修改浏览器的源码,应该是做不到的
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-5-19 07:38 , Processed in 0.099294 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表